Output d59bbd82ace769bc21399331ceaed597e3beecdf843b1b50b0e68ca869fe2381:0

value
586488
script pubkey
OP_0 OP_PUSHBYTES_32 e383ed56690d8e376bbdf5675aab2fd241021584bdb2f44dbce3d2141822476e
address
bc1quwp764nfpk8rw6aa74n442e06fqsy9vyhke0gnduu0fpgxpzgahqurxzqk
transaction
d59bbd82ace769bc21399331ceaed597e3beecdf843b1b50b0e68ca869fe2381